Many digital tools focus on the artistic, "glossy" side of fashion. However, Il Figurino Di Moda distinguishes itself by bridging the gap between illustration and pattern making. It teaches the language of sartoria —how to accurately draw technical flats (flat drawings) that a factory can actually understand and produce. The most daunting task for any fashion student is mastering the "9-head" figure proportion standard. Il Figurino Di Moda solves this instantly by providing correctly proportioned croquis (figure templates).
